互相关函数在声学测温系统中的误差分析 被引量:8

Error Analysis of Acoustic Pyrometer Based on Cross-correlation Method

摘要 由于炉膛背景噪声的影响和实际中用于互相关运算的采样点数不可能无限大,声学测温系统中采用的互相关函数测量的声波飞渡时间的方法是存在误差的。文章从理论上给出了这一误差的方差表达式,并分析了影响这一误差的因素,通过选取合适的互相关运算点数。采样频率和具有尖锐自相关特性的声波信号,能有效降低这一测量误差。 There is an error in acoustic pyrometer using cross-correlation to measure the acoustic waves flight time because of the finite sampling points and the strong noise from burning. In this paper, the variance of the error and the factor associated with it are given. In order to reduce this error, the .sampling frequency, the number of the .sampling points and the acoustic waves with better correlation characteristic should be adequately selected.
